Manager Workforce Strategy and Culture

2 weeks ago


Melbourne, Victoria, Australia Water and Catchments - DEECA Full time $80,000 - $120,000 per year

Company description:

Department of Energy, Environment and Climate Action

Job description:

The Manager Workforce Strategy and Culture will play a critical role to ensure the group has the workforce, culture and capability it needs to be successful and achieve its objectives.

The role will prepare and provide strategic and technical advice; deliver programs and projects and operational support and services for the Office of the Deputy Secretary, Senior Leaders and employees within the group and work closely with a range of internal and external stakeholders.

You will champion a safe, positive and engaged workplace culture utilising your innovative and technical human resource skill set to drive connected initiatives and services

This position is classified as an "identified position" aimed at increasing employment opportunities for Australian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ander People. The position requires an in-depth knowledge of Aboriginal culture and an ability to communicate with Aboriginal communities. Australian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people are encouraged to apply.

Specialist/Technical Expertise/Qualifications

  • Demonstrated experience in development and delivery of workforce planning and organisation development in a government environment is highly desirable.

This is a fixed term position available for a period of 2 years. The work location for this position is 8 Nicholson Street, East Melbourne, with hybrid work arrangements available.
